Homeland Security Threats

Transwestern recommends that each tenant have an emergency action plan in place to help their employees prepare for and react quickly to a regional emergency, including terrorist attacks. The Department of Homeland Security has provided a fact sheet for Tools and Resources to Help Businesses Plan, Prepare and Protect from an Attack.
